This 06 days Hunza tour by air is ideal for travelers who want to explore the breathtaking beauty of Hunza in a short yet comfortable way. This travel to Hunza allows you to explore more in less time.

For your information, we recommend the below seasons for planning this trip.

  1. Spring Cherry Blossom tour of Hunza, which starts in the middle of March and lasts until the middle of April.
  2. Summer Hunza Valley tour, from May to August.
  3. Hunza Autumn tour, where autumn is observed from the middle of September to mid of November.

This Hunza by air trip is recommended during spring, summer, and autumn because the weather is very pleasant. Spring turns the valley into a sea of white with blooming apricot and cherry blossoms. As the leaves change color, the valley turns golden yellow in autumn, creating a beautiful contrast against the mountains.

Itinerary of Hunza Valley Tour by air for 06 Days.

Fly to Gilgit or Skardu Valley:

On the first day, fly to either Gilgit City or Skardu Valley. These are the only places with airports in Gilgit-Baltistan. Start your drive towards Hunza Valley, which is 2 hours away from Gilgit city and 4 hours from Skardu. Along the way, you can explore Gilgit City, the Rakaposhi viewpoint, and Nagar Valley.

Tour of Central Hunza Valley and Surroundings:

On the second day, you can explore central Hunza, which offers both heritage and cultural tours. On this day, you will visit the ancient Altit and Baltit Forts, which are more than 800 years old. Apart from the fort visits you can also explore Karimabad Bazar, the Hunza Food Pavilion for local cuisine, and Duiker the Heights point for sunset.

Upper Hunza Gojal Tour

On the third, explore Upper Hunza, called Gojal Valley. This valley is located 35 minutes from central Hunza. This valley holds the beautiful Attabad and Borith lakes, the famous Hussaini Suspension Bridge, and the Passu cones. You will also be able to explore Gulmit village and the longest stairs in Pakistan, called Ondra Poyga.

Khunjerab National Park Tour:

Khunjerab National Park and the Pakistan-China Border also Lie in Gojal Valley. On this day, you will explore the Passu Valley and its famous Rainbow Bridge. Furthermore, with a 3-hour drive our guests will enter the Khunjerab National Park at Deh.

Visit the famous Rakaposhi viewpoint located at Miacher Kho.

Miacher Kho is a meadow located in Nagar Valley, which is adjacent to Hunza Valley. This place is accessible via a 4x4 jeep. Our clients will enjoy the beautiful view of Rakaposhi Peak and the Rakaposhi Glacier below on arrival at the top.
